Description

Clara Ellen Maria Davies, 1862-1951, one of seven children whose father, Vaughan Palmer Davies, lived and farmed on Skomer Island for 30 years, from 1862 to 1892.

Clara was born on Skomer in 1862 and at the time of departure from the island in 1892, with the exception of her time at finishing school, she had lived on Skomer her whole life.
After leaving the island, she lived as a companion to her aunt Elizabeth Annie Robinson in Romford and, fourteen years after leaving Skomer, at the age of 44, she married Percy Bacon, a stained-glass designer.

Clara was a gifted photographer, whose images provide a very personal insight into life on Skomer during the Victorian era.
